Critical Adobe Flash Player Patch Released

Simply Put: Adobe has released a critical patch to address seven security vulnerabilities regarding its Flash Player and Adobe Air products. Flash is used on most websites for active content, such as animated or interactive menus and images, and movies.  Adobe Air allows users to run active web content outside of a browser.  These vulnerabilities have been rated Critical and could lead to remote code execution or information disclosure.  Flash versions older than 10.0.42.34 and Air versions older than 1.5.3 are affected by these issues.  Gladiator recommends that these patches are applied to all workstations as soon as possible. Users running Flash Player 9 should upgrade to version 10 at this time.
